Active fan and vapor chamber prototype surfaces in Chinese leaks
Engineering details shared by insider Smart Pikachu on Weibo reveal that iQOO is currently prototyping a hybrid cooling system for the iQOO 16T. The design pairs a physical internal air-circulation fan directly with a liquid-filled vapor chamber to combat thermal throttling during prolonged gaming sessions.
While active fan cooling has traditionally been restricted to dedicated, bulky gaming phones, iQOO is attempting to integrate this dual-mechanism setup into a standard slim flagship chassis without compromising day-to-day ergonomics.
Inside the leaked specifications and camera array
The latest hardware reports outline several core hardware choices defining the upcoming device:
- A primary 200MP main camera sensor offering 4x lossless digital crop, though omitting a dedicated periscope telephoto lens to conserve internal space for the thermal assembly.
- A high-resolution 2K OLED panel supplied by Samsung, designed for high refresh rates and reduced power draw.
- Next-generation processing powered by Qualcomm's Snapdragon 8 Elite Gen 6 platform, paired with dedicated display co-processors.
This layout follows the trajectory established by its predecessor, the iQOO 15T, which launched in May featuring an 8,000mAh battery and 100W fast wired charging.
The shift toward active cooling in everyday consumer hardware
The decision to implement combined liquid-and-air active cooling highlights a broader dilemma facing modern mobile hardware engineering. As mobile processors consume higher peak power to run complex on-device AI tasks and console-grade games, passive heat sinks reach physical limits within standard glass-and-metal frames.
For everyday users, iQOO's experimental design suggests that future performance phones will prioritize sustained frame rates and battery longevity over ultra-thin profiles, proving that active thermal management is moving from niche gaming accessories directly into main-series consumer devices.
